To pass out
Exemple : They pass out from exhaustion
Definition
"To pass out" means to lose consciousness temporarily, often due to exhaustion, illness, or lack of oxygen. It describes the act of fainting or becoming unconscious without warning, as in the phrase 'They pass out from exhaustion.'
Étymologie
The phrase "to pass out" originated in the early 19th century, deriving from the idea of 'passing' beyond a state of awareness or consciousness. The term 'pass' in this context means to go beyond or through, and 'out' emphasizes leaving the current state, resulting in the combined meaning of losing consciousness.
